Kankakee — 2 nights

On the 6th (Wed), look for all kinds of wild species at Midewin National Tallgrass Prairie, then don't miss a visit to Gemini Giant, and then examine the collection at Exploration Station...a children's museum. On the 7th (Thu), you'll have a packed day of sightseeing: get engrossed in the history at French Heritage Museum at The Stone Barn, admire the landmark architecture of B. Harley Bradley House, then examine the collection at Kankakee County Museum, and finally discover the deep blue sea with Haigh Quarry.
